This candid wide-angle photograph captures an everyday street scene in Nyanya, Nigeria, under soft, diffused lighting, suggesting either early morning or late afternoon. The sky appears slightly hazy, and distinct shadows are absent. The street itself comprises a paved asphalt section for vehicles and a parallel unpaved dirt path on the left.

On the left side, a series of simple, possibly commercial structures or stalls with corrugated metal roofs and walls line the dirt path. These buildings appear worn, and a significant amount of visible trash and debris, including plastic bags and other refuse, litters the ground in front of them, bordering a patch of green grass. A person is visible pushing a cart or tricycle in the mid-ground on this side, while further down, another individual rides a motorcycle approaching the viewer. In the distance, a modern street lamp with a solar panel stands out.

The right side of the street features more established buildings, likely residences or shops, some with white-painted walls. Multiple wooden utility poles with electrical wires extend along this side; notably, one pole in the mid-ground leans conspicuously. Several people are present, including a person riding a motorcycle away from the viewer in the foreground, and other figures walking or standing further down the road near the buildings.

The image portrays a typical urban or semi-urban environment in Nigeria, characterized by a mix of infrastructure and ongoing daily activities. No legible text is discernible on any visible signs or posters.
